WebBoy Scouts of America [ edit] Cub Scouts use the two finger Scout sign and salute—the sign is presented with the fingers apart to represent the ears of Akela the wolf. Scouts BSA, Venturers and Sea Scouts use the three finger sign and salute. The Scout sign is performed with the upper arm parallel to the ground and the forearm vertical ...

WebOath: A solemn, formal declaration or promise to fulfill a pledge, often calling on God as witness. On my honor, I will do my best. To do my duty to God and my Country and to obey the Scout Law; To help other people at all times; To keep myself physically strong, mentally awake, and morally straight. The Scout measures themselves against these ideals and continually tries to improve. The goals are high ... flight aa101WebSep 1, 1995 · Be Prepared. That's the motto of the Boy Scouts. "Be prepared for what?" someone once asked Baden-Powell, the founder of Scouting, "Why, for any old thing." said Baden-Powell.
